Subtract 98/45 from 3/48

1st number: 3/48, 2nd number: 2 8/45

3/48 - 98/45 is -1523/720.

Steps for subtracting fractions

  1.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
    LCM of 48 and 45 is 720

    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 720
  2. For the 1st fraction, since 48 × 15 = 720,
    3/48 = 3 × 15/48 × 15 = 45/720
  3.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 45 × 16 = 720,
    98/45 = 98 × 16/45 × 16 = 1568/720
  4. Subtract the two like fractions:
    45/720 - 1568/720 = 45 - 1568/720 = -1523/720
